Subject: Closure of the Gartley Street Office

To the executive team and branch managers: after careful review, we will wind down the Gartley Street office over the next two quarters. All twelve staff will be offered transfers to the Renmoor site, and lease obligations end in autumn. The broader rationale for this decision is summarized confidentially below.

board note of bawep-taweg: Soriusix Foods plans to lower the Kelys list price by 52 percent in October.

Facilities ticket — Night shift, Brindlecote Campus. Twenty-two interns from the Fennhollow programme arrive tomorrow at 08:00. Please unlock seminar rooms B2 and B3 by 06:30, set chairs to classroom layout, and confirm the water coolers on level one are refilled. Leave the loading bay clear for their equipment van. Overnight access to the prep corridor requires the pass code below.

badge for bajop-yawep: bdg-NNHEW-6

**Mgmt Meeting Minutes — Retiring the Brightline Range**

Quick recap for sales leads at Fenholt Supplies: we agreed to retire the Brightline fixture range by year-end. Remaining stock moves to clearance pricing next month, and accounts on standing orders get migrated to the Lumetta range. Trade-in incentives were approved in principle. The confidential note on next steps sits just below.

board note of bajof-bajeg: The pricing group signed off on a budget of $13.4 million for Project Sildor. The renewal with Lamixek Holdings closes at $48.9 million a year, 49 percent above the last contract.